Genmitsu LC-40 10W Laser Module Installation Guide
Step 1: Remove the Cable Clips
This step involves detaching the existing cable management clips from the laser module.
Instructions:
- Unscrew the screw securing cable clip A on the laser module.
- Remove cable clip B, then detach the cables from the laser module.
Visual Description: The image shows a laser module mounted on a linear rail system. A close-up view highlights cable clip A and cable clip B attached to the module's housing. A screw is visible securing cable clip A.
Step 2: Remove the Original Laser Module
This step details the removal of the existing laser module from the machine.
Instructions:
- Unscrew the four M3*6 screws that attach the original laser module to the mounting plate.
- Carefully remove the original laser module from the mounting plate.
Visual Description: The original laser module is shown attached to a mounting plate on the rail system. Red arrows indicate four M3*6 screws securing the module. Below this, the mounting plate is shown after the original laser module has been removed.
Step 3: Install the 10W Laser Module
This step guides the installation of the new 10W laser module.
Instructions:
- Position the 10W laser module onto the mounting plate.
- Secure the 10W laser module by tightening the four M3*6 screws (previously used for the original module) into the mounting plate.
Visual Description: The new 10W laser module is positioned above the mounting plate. Red arrows point to four M3*6 screws that will be used to attach it. Below this, the 10W laser module is shown securely mounted to the plate.
Step 4: Install the Cable Clips
This final step involves reattaching the cable management clips and reconnecting the cables.
Instructions:
- Reinstall cable clip B and cable clip A back onto the 10W laser module, securing them with the screw.
- Reconnect the cables to the 10W laser module in the same manner they were removed.
The installation is now complete.
